==Campuses== [[File:Senate House, University of London.jpg|thumb|[[Senate House, London|Senate House]], constructed 1932β1937: the headquarters of the University of London]] The university owns a considerable [[central London]] estate of 12 hectares of freehold land in [[Bloomsbury]], near [[Russell Square tube station]].<ref>{{cite web| url=http://www.london.ac.uk/138.html| title=The Central University's Estate| publisher=University of London| access-date=22 June 2016| url-status=dead| arch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20060213000715/http://www.london.ac.uk/138.html| archive-date=13 February 2006| df=dmy-all}}</ref> Some of the university's colleges have their main buildings on the estate. The Bloomsbury Campus also contains eight Halls of Residence and [[Senate House (University of London)|Senate House]], which houses [[Senate House Library]], the chancellor's official residence and previously housed the [[School of Slavonic and East European Studies]], now part of [[University College London]] (UCL) and housed in its own new building. Almost all of the [[School of Advanced Study]] is housed in Senate House and neighbouring Stewart House.<ref>{{cite web| url=http://w01.sascms.wf.ulcc.ac.uk/348.html| title=Redevelopment Project of Senate House and Stewart House| publisher=University of London School of Advanced Study| access-date=2 March 2007| url-status=dead| arch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20070928031207/http://w01.sascms.wf.ulcc.ac.uk/348.html| archive-date=28 September 2007| df=dmy-all}}</ref> The university also owns many of the squares that formed part of the Bedford Estate, including [[Gordon Square]], [[Tavistock Square]], [[Torrington Square]] and [[Woburn Square]], as well as several properties outside Bloomsbury, with many of the university's colleges and institutes occupying their own estates across London: * [[Clare Market]], * The [[Aldwych]], where the [[London School of Economics and Political Science]] and part of [[King's College London]] are based * The North and East Wings of [[Somerset House]], the location for the [[Courtauld Institute of Art]] and [[King's College London]], respectively * [[St Bartholomew's Hospital]], * the [[University of London Boat Club]] in [[Chiswick]], and * The campus of [[Royal Holloway and Bedford New College]] including the historic [[Founder's Building]]. The university also has several properties outside London, including a number of residential and catering units further afield and the premises of the [[University of London Institute in Paris]], which offers undergraduate and postgraduate degrees in French and historical studies.
